http://www.newsobserver.com...pport.html

Senate leader Phil Berger's office is highlighting a range of support for the gas tax bill making its way to the Senate floor on Wednesday.

The plan would cut the tax on March 1, but set a floor that analysts say in a consensus forecast would generate an additional $1.2 billion in gas tax revenue for the state. In other words, it represents an increase in taxes in the long run.

Two other groups � the conservative Americans For Prosperity and the liberal Progress N.C. Action � had both criticized the plan as an unneeded tax hike.
